Quantum Experimentalist at CERN
Devanshi Arora is a quantum experimentalist at CERN, specializing in enhanced quantum systems for high-energy particle physics applications, particularly in scintillating detectors. She has contributed to research on chromatic calorimetry, aiming to improve energy resolution and particle identification by layering scintillators with different emission wavelengths. Her work also includes studies on photonic quantum computing and quantum error correction methods for superconducting quantum devices.

Dr. A. Satyanarayana Reddy is an Associate Professor in the Department of Mathematics at Shiv Nadar University (SNU). He earned his Ph.D. from the Indian Institute of Technology Kanpur. His research interests include Algebraic Graph Theory, Combinatorial Matrix Theory, and Algebraic Number Theory. Dr. Reddy has published numerous articles in these areas, focusing on topics such as polynomials divisible by cyclotomic polynomials, Ramanujan sums, circulant matrices, and their applications in signal and image processing. At SNU, he teaches courses like Graph Theory, Linear Algebra, and Algebraic Number Theory.

Dr. Samarendra Pratap Singh is a Professor in the School of Natural Sciences at Shiv Nadar University (SNU). He earned his Ph.D. in Physics from the Indian Institute of Technology Kanpur (IITK) in 2007. His research interests encompass advanced materials and surface engineering, alternative energy sources such as solar, wind, and biofuels, as well as semiconductor materials and devices. Dr. Singh has an extensive publication record, with numerous articles focusing on organic electronics and related fields. At SNU, he teaches courses in his areas of expertise and has been recognized with awards for both teaching and research excellence.

Professor Ayan Banerjee is a physicist at IISER Kolkata, specializing in optical micromanipulation, precision spectroscopy, and biophotonics. (iiserkol.ac.in) He earned his Ph.D. from IISc Bengaluru and previously worked at GE Global Research. At IISER Kolkata, he leads the Light-Matter Interaction Lab and co-founded the RISE Foundation for deep-tech startups. He has over 50 publications, 22 patents, and is also an accomplished playwright and theatre artist.

Dr. Sanjukta Roy is an Associate Professor at the Raman Research Institute (RRI), Bengaluru, specializing in quantum technologies with ultra-cold Rydberg atoms. (rri.res.in) Her research focuses on quantum simulation, few-body physics, and light-matter interactions. She has contributed to advancements in quantum optics and experimental atomic physics.

Dr. Bodhaditya Santra is an Assistant Professor in the Department of Physics at IIT Delhi, where he leads the Cold Atom Quantum Technologies lab, focusing on quantum simulation, computing, communication, and sensing. He earned his Ph.D. in experimental physics from the University of Groningen in 2013 and pursued postdoctoral research at the University of Kaiserslautern, the University of Hamburg, and the University of Innsbruck. His work involves cooling and trapping atoms using lasers to explore quantum phenomena. In addition to his academic role, he is the co-founder and CTO of PrenishQ Pvt. Ltd., contributing to advancements in quantum technologies.
